commitment to the community.Under the general supervision of
department supervisor, Patent Analyst works as part of a team to
provide patent prosecution services to clients. Principal
responsibilities are to provide task project support to attorneys,
paralegals, and other team members.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:Performs
patent prosecution tasks including but not limited to:
- Client (internal) counseling for reference management
procedures and client reporting
- Prepare Information Disclosure Statements (IDS) for submission
to USPTO and other patent offices
- Liaise with vendor to coordinate reference management and IDS
support
- Reference management within firm software (marking, tracking,
and auditing references)
- Memorialize and track IDS projects
- Filing documents for submission to the USPTOAssist in preparing
and filing of formalities-related documents for submission to the
USPTO and Foreign Associates with tasks including but not limited
to:
- Preparing Declarations, Powers of Attorney, Assignments,
additional ownership documents, and change requests; recording
ownership documents with the USPTO and other foreign offices
- Facilitating client signatures, including preparation of
documents using secure software
- Memorialize and track formalities projectsInteracts with client
software systems, to include client reporting, document uploads,
and data management.Performs post-grant tasks including but not
limited to patent proofreading and reporting letters patents to
client.Works on various other projects as needed both
administrative and legal. -KNOWLEDGE/SKILLS REQUIRED:
